core: rework crash handling

This introduces a new systemd.crash_reboot=1 kernel command line option
that triggers a reboot after crashing.

This also cleans up crash VT handling. Specifically, it cleans up the
configuration setting, to be between 1..63 or a boolean. This is to
replace the previous logic where "-1" meant disabled. We continue to
accept that setting, but only document the boolean syntax instead.

This also brings the documentation of the default settings in sync with
what actually happens.

The CrashChVT= configuration file setting is renamed to CrashChangeVT=,
following our usual logic of not abbreviating unnecessarily. The old
setting stays support for compat reasons.

Fixes #1300
